Wells City Harrier members have been competing at both the National and European level this past week. Whilst some of the junior members were selected for the Somerset Schools team competing at the prestigious English Schools Championships in Manchester, another was part of theTeamGB squad that competed in Estonia. Elise Thorner finished 8th in the 3000m Steeplechase at the European u23 Athletics Championships in Tallinn, whilst Harry Barton is now the English Schools Senior boys Champion for 110m Hurdles. There were also good runs by Hannah Blundy & Sophie Nicholls at the same Championships. 20 year old Wells City Harrier Ollie Thorner finished 6th in the senior men’s decathlon at last weekend’s (25th-27th June) British Athletics Track & Field Championships held in Manchester. Whilst this last Wednesday (30th June) Elise Thorner heard that she had been selected to compete for TeamGB in the 3000m Steeplechase at the European U23 Championships to be held in Tallinn, Estonia, commencing at the end of next week. Meanwhile Harriers of all ages have continued to train hard at the Club’s various sessions, with a number of new members joining us this past month. Wells City Harrier 17 year old Harry Barton came away with the 110m Hurdles silver medal after an excellent performance in the England Athletics Track & Field Championships for u20 & u23 age groups held last weekend (20th June) at Bedford. No wonder he picked up the County Schools Gold the previous weekend (12th June), where a number of other Harrier juniors were also in competition and achieving personal bests.
